Over 200 pairs of new shoes distributed in waterlogged Calais

‘This week, we gave out more than 200 pairs of brand new walking boots and trainers at two different sites in Calais. I always look forward to these distributions, as shoes are one of the things we get asked for most often. Especially now, as many of the places where refugees sleep are muddy or completely waterlogged. Each time I go out, I have to put on my walking boots, so it was really nice to be able to offer the refugees new, waterproof boots – they have to spend the majority of their time in the waterlogged areas.
The distribution at the bigger site took place in the pouring rain, but still more than 200 people came and lined up patiently. This, more than anything, shows how much they need the shoes. We handed out plastic ponchos but still it was freezing cold and wet. I’m so glad they had something good to show for it.
Everyone we spoke to afterwards was so pleased with their new shoes, and it was great to see them being worn straight away, especially as it has been so wet over the last few weeks.’
– Imogen, Care4Calais Warehouse Manager
